body{
 font-size:100%;
}

.regular_001 {
font-family:Arial, Helvetica, sans-serif;
font-size:0.84em; 
font-weight:normal;
color:#000000;
margin:2px;
}


.regular_002 {
font-family:Arial, Helvetica, sans-serif;
font-size:0.67em; 
font-weight:normal;
color:#000000;
margin:2px;
} 

.regular_003 {
font-family:Arial, Helvetica, sans-serif;
font-size:0.5em; 
font-weight:normal;
color:#000000;
margin:2px;
} 

.regular_bold_001 {
font-family:Arial, Helvetica, sans-serif;
font-size:0.84em; 
font-weight:bold;
color:#000000;
margin:20px;
}  

.Instruction_msg_001 {
font-family:Arial, Helvetica, sans-serif;
font-size:0.84em; 
font-weight:bold;
color:#0066FF;
margin:20px;
}  

.links_001 {
	color:#2E66CC;
	cursor:pointer;
	text-decoration:underline;
	font-family:Arial, Helvetica, sans-serif;
	font-weight:normal;
}



.Heading_001{
	font-family:Arial, Helvetica, sans-serif;
	margin-top:50px;
	font-size:1.5em; 
	font-weight:bold;
	color:#336699;
}



.Heading_002{
	font-family:Arial, Helvetica, sans-serif;
	font-size:1.25em; 
	font-weight:bold;
	color:#336699;
}


.Heading_003{
	font-family:Arial, Helvetica, sans-serif;
	font-size:1em; 
	font-weight:bold;
	color:#336699;
}


.Heading_004{
	font-family:Arial, Helvetica, sans-serif;
	font-size:1em; 
	font-weight:bold;
	color:#ffffff;
}


.dropdown_001 {
font-family:Arial, Helvetica, sans-serif;
font-size:0.84em; 
font-weight:normal;
color:#000000;
margin:2px;
}

.greyFeather_001{
	display:block;
	background-image:url(/commonImages/grey_feather.gif);
	transform:rotate(0deg);
	-ms-transform:rotate(0deg);
	filter: progid:DXImageTransform.Microsoft.BasicImage(rotation=0);
}

.greyFeather_002 { 
    display: block; 
    background-image: url(/commonImages/grey_feather.gif); 
    -moz-transform: rotate(180deg); 
    -o-transform: rotate(180deg); 
    -webkit-transform: rotate(180deg); 
    transform: rotate(180deg); 
    -ms-transform: rotate(180deg); 
    filter: progid:DXImageTransform.Microsoft.BasicImage(rotation=2); 
}


.UnOrderList_001{
	color:#1F497D;
}



input.blue_button { 
	background-image:url(/commonImages/imgBgButtomBlue.gif);
	color:#FFFFFF; 
	background-color:#2E5F8D;
	width:auto !important;
	padding-left:8px;
	padding-right:8px;
	padding-top:0px;
	padding-bottom:0px;
	border-top-width:1px;
	border-bottom-width:1px;
	border-right-width:1px;
	border-left-width:1px;
	height:24px !important; 
	cursor:pointer;
	font-size:0.82em !important;
	font-family:Arial, Helvetica, sans-serif !important;
	overflow:visible;
}


TR.TR_Content_001
{
font-family:Arial, Helvetica, sans-serif;
font-size:0.84em; 
font-weight:normal;
color:#000000;
background-color:#cccccc;
}

TR.TR_Content_002
{
font-family:Arial, Helvetica, sans-serif;
font-size:0.84em; 
font-weight:normal;
color:#000000;
background-color: None;
}

TR.TR_Content_003
{
font-family:Arial, Helvetica, sans-serif;
font-size:0.84em; 
font-weight:normal;
color:#000000;
background-color: #d3d3d3;
}


TR.TR_Content_004
{
font-family:Arial, Helvetica, sans-serif;
font-size:0.67em; 
font-weight:normal;
color:#000000;
background-color: #BCD2EE;
}


TR.TR_Content_005
{
font-family:Arial, Helvetica, sans-serif;
font-size:0.67em; 
font-weight:normal;
color:#000000;
background-color: None;
}


TR.TR_Content_006
{
font-family:Arial, Helvetica, sans-serif;
font-weight:normal;
color:#000000;
background-color: None;
}

TR.TR_Content_007
{
font-family:Arial, Helvetica, sans-serif;
font-weight:normal;
color:#000000;
background-color: #d3d3d3;
}

TR.TR_Content_008
{
font-family:Arial, Helvetica, sans-serif; 
font-weight:normal;
color:#000000;
background-color: #BCD2EE;
}




TD.TD_Content_001
{
    FONT-STYLE: normal;
    FONT-FAMILY: Arial, verdana;
    COLOR: #000000;
    FONT-SIZE: 0.67em;
    FONT-WEIGHT: normal;
    PADDING-Top: 1pt;
    PADDING-Bottom: 1pt;
    TEXT-ALIGN: center;
    BORDER-TOP-STYLE: Solid;
    BORDER-TOP-WIDTH: 1px;
    BORDER-TOP-COLOR: #000000; 
    BORDER-LEFT-STYLE: Solid;
    BORDER-LEFT-WIDTH: 1px;
    BORDER-LEFT-COLOR: #000000;
}
TD.TD_Content_002
{
    FONT-STYLE: normal;
    FONT-FAMILY: Arial, verdana;
    COLOR: #000000;
    FONT-SIZE: 0.67em;
    FONT-WEIGHT: bold;
    PADDING-Top: 1pt;
    PADDING-Bottom: 1pt;
    TEXT-ALIGN: center;
    BORDER-TOP-STYLE: Solid;
    BORDER-TOP-WIDTH: 1px;
    BORDER-TOP-COLOR: #000000;
    BORDER-BOTTOM-STYLE: Solid;
    BORDER-BOTTOM-WIDTH: 1px;
    BORDER-BOTTOM-COLOR: #000000; 
    BORDER-LEFT-STYLE: Solid;
    BORDER-LEFT-WIDTH: 1px;
    BORDER-LEFT-COLOR: #000000;
}


TH.TH_Content_001
{
    FONT-STYLE: normal;
    FONT-FAMILY: Arial, verdana;
    COLOR: #000000;
    FONT-SIZE: 0.67em;
    FONT-WEIGHT: bold;
    background-color:#BCD2EE;
    PADDING-Top: 1pt;
    PADDING-Bottom: 1pt;
    TEXT-ALIGN: center;
    BORDER-TOP-STYLE: Solid;
    BORDER-TOP-WIDTH: 1px;
    BORDER-TOP-COLOR: #000000; 
    BORDER-LEFT-STYLE: Solid;
    BORDER-LEFT-WIDTH: 1px;
    BORDER-LEFT-COLOR: #000000;
}


.Field_Label_001 {
font-family:Arial, Helvetica, sans-serif;
font-size:0.84em; 
font-weight:bold;
color:#000000;
margin:20px;
} 


.Field_001 {
font-family:Arial, Helvetica, sans-serif;
font-size:0.84em; 
font-weight:normal;
color:#000000;
margin:20px;
}  
 



TABLE.Content_001
{
    BORDER-RIGHT-STYLE: Solid;
    BORDER-RIGHT-WIDTH: 1px;
    BORDER-RIGHT-COLOR: #000000;
}


.BoxBorder_001
{
    BORDER-RIGHT: #cccccc thin groove;
    BORDER-TOP: #cccccc thin groove;
    BORDER-LEFT: #cccccc thin groove;
    BORDER-BOTTOM: #cccccc thin groove;
}



.Footnotes_001 {
font-family:Arial, Helvetica, sans-serif;
font-size:0.67em; 
font-weight:normal;
color:#000000;
} 


.Alert_msg_001 {
font-family:Arial, Helvetica, sans-serif;
font-size:0.84em; 
font-weight:bold;
color:#ff0000;
} 


.Legend_title_001 {
font-family:Arial, Helvetica, sans-serif;
font-size:0.84em; 
font-weight:bold;
color:#336699;
}  


.Banner_001{
	background-color: #1B4781
}




/*format table general*/
.cssTable thead tr th { text-align: left; border-style: solid; border-color: lightgray; border-bottom-color: #6E6E6E; border-width: 1px; padding-left: 3px; padding-right: 3px; border-right-width: 0px; }
    .cssTable thead tr th a { color: #2E66CC; }
.cssTable { border-width: 1px; border-style: solid; border-color: #6E6E6E; width: 100%; }
    .cssTable tbody tr td { text-align: left; border-color: lightgray; padding-left: 3px; }
    .cssTable thead tr th { text-align: center;}
/*format table general*/




.PageNormal
{
    PADDING-BOTTOM: 5pt;
    FONT-STYLE: normal;
    PADDING-LEFT: 2pt;
    PADDING-RIGHT: 5pt;
    FONT-FAMILY: Arial, Verdana;
    COLOR: black;
    FONT-SIZE: 12px;
    FONT-WEIGHT: bolder;
    PADDING-TOP: 5pt
}

.CASL_Heading_001 {
font-family:Antenna, Arial, Helvetica, sans-serif;
font-size:30pt; 
color:#ffffff;
font-weight:bold;
margin:2px;
}

.CASL_Heading_002 {
font-family:Antenna, Arial, Helvetica, sans-serif;
font-size:16pt; 
font-weight:bold;
color:#ffffff;
margin:2px;
}

.CASL_Heading_003 {
font-family:Antenna, Arial, Helvetica, sans-serif;
font-size:14pt; 
font-weight:normal;
color:#ffffff;
margin:2px;
}

.CASL_Heading_004 {
font-family:Antenna, Arial, Helvetica, sans-serif;
font-size:18pt; 
font-weight:normal;
color:#ffffff;
margin:2px;
}

.CASL_Heading_005 {
font-family:Antenna, Arial, Helvetica, sans-serif;
font-size:16pt; 
font-weight:normal;
color:#ffffff;
margin:2px;
}

.CASL_Heading_006 {
font-family:Antenna, Arial, Helvetica, sans-serif;
font-size:22pt; 
color:#595959;
font-weight:bold;
margin:2px;
}


.CASL_Black_Heading_001 {
font-family:Antenna, Arial, Helvetica, sans-serif;
font-size:30pt; 
color:#000000;
font-weight:bold;
margin:2px;
}


.CASL_Black_Heading_002 {
font-family:Antenna, Arial, Helvetica, sans-serif;
font-size:11pt; 
font-weight:bold;
color:#000000;
margin:2px;
}

.CASL_Black_Heading_003 {
font-family:Antenna, Arial, Helvetica, sans-serif;
font-size:22pt; 
font-weight:bold;
color:#000000;
margin:2px;
}




.CASL_Regular_001 {
font-family:Antenna, Arial, Helvetica, sans-serif;
font-size:11pt; 
font-weight:normal;
color:#000000;
}


.CASL_Regular_002 {
font-family:Antenna, Arial, Helvetica, sans-serif;
font-size:11pt; 
font-weight:normal;
color:#859EBE;
text-decoration:none
}


.CASL_Regular_003 {
font-family:Antenna, Arial, Helvetica, sans-serif;
font-size:12pt; 
font-weight:normal;
color:#ffffff;
}


.CASL_Link_001{
font-family:Antenna, Helvetica, sans-serif;
font-size:16pt; 
font-weight:normal;
color:#ffffff;
margin:2px;
}


.CASL_Link_002 {
font-family:Antenna, Arial, Helvetica, sans-serif;
font-size:10pt; 
font-weight:normal;
color:#859EBE;
text-decoration:none
}




.CASL_Footer_001 {
font-family:Antenna, Arial, Helvetica, sans-serif;
font-size:10pt; 
font-weight:normal;
color:#000000;
}

.CASL_Footer_002 {
font-family:Antenna, Arial, Helvetica, sans-serif;
font-size:8pt; 
font-weight:normal;
color:#000000;
}













